Distance from Newark to Rajahmundry

There are several ways to calculate the distance from Newark to Rajahmundry. Here are two standard methods:

Vincenty's formula (applied above)
  • 8166.967 miles
  • 13143.459 kilometers
  • 7096.900 nautical miles

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.

Haversine formula
  • 8155.913 miles
  • 13125.669 kilometers
  • 7087.294 nautical miles

The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).
